==Goal average==
Football leagues used to use goal average instead of goal difference (see [[1965–66 Bundesliga]]). Goal average is calculated by dividing goals for by goals against. Is there a way to implement this in these tables? [[User:EddieV2003|EddieV2003]] ([[User talk:EddieV2003|talk]]) 02:45, 16 January 2015 (UTC)
